Opportunity description
Disney is offering Technology internship with the 6abc Community Engagement Department is designed to provide one student with a general understanding of the many facets of Community Engagement within the fast-paced media industry.
The WPVI Technology team is responsible for designing and maintaining the broadcast, IT, and newsroom systems which enable WPVI to create and deliver the news each and every day. In this internship you will be working with senior engineers and project managers helping to test new software deployments, develop training materials, and troubleshoot broadcast issues as they come up. Everyday there will be a new opportunity to learn something new about what it takes to be the #1 broadcast station in the country.
Duties & responsibilities
Each day you will be rolling up your sleeves both metaphorically and literally to get to the bottom of any and all problems faced. On some days you will spend time with our production teams to understand their workflows and then meet with engineers to propose and implement timesaving solutions. Then on the next day you will work with a design engineer to put together an equipment list for a new studio build and ensure delivery will meet our needs.
Eligibility criteria
- Familiar with basic video production
- Understanding of Television Production Workflows
- Desire to be part of a fast moving agile organization
- Attention to detail, exacting standards, and superior organization skills
- Major or previous coursework in Broadcast Journalism, Communications, Video Production, or related major
- Must be enrolled in an accredited college/university taking at least one class in the semester/quarter (spring/fall) prior to participation in the internship program OR must have graduated from a college/university within 18 months OR currently participating in a Disney College Program or Disney Professional Internship
- Must be at least 18 years of age
- Must not have completed one year of continual employment on a Disney internship or program.
- Must possess unrestricted work authorization
- All candidates must be able to have a consistent, reliable work schedule throughout the session
- All candidates must be able to work in the Philadelphia office and provide their own housing and transportation for the duration of the internship
- All candidates must be available from September 2021 through January 2022
- All candidates must be available to work 20 hours per week during a Monday through Sunday schedule (hours and days to be determined by your supervisor, and could include nights, weekends and holidays)
